Assault Charges FAQs

1. How Do We Define Violent Threat In Law?

Aggression is generally defined as the purposeful act of causing another individual expect physical injury. It can include anything from verbal threats to physical attacks. The exact interpretation and seriousness of the accusation changes by state.

2. What Is the Difference Between Violent Threat and Battery?

Assault is the threat of violence or an attempt to injure someone, while physical harm entails actual physical contact. In some jurisdictions, both aggression and harm are separate charges; in others, they may be merged.

3. What Are The Various Types of Assault?

Assault is often classified into levels, depending on the severity of the event:

  • Basic Aggression - Slight harm or threats without the presence of a weapon.
  • Serious Aggression - Includes major damage or the involvement of a lethal object.
  • Major Assault - Generally entails severe harm or deliberate action to create substantial injury.

8. What Defines Defending Yourself and How Might It Relate To Assault Accusations?

Self-defense is a legal defense where you argue that you took action to defend yourself from immediate danger. To use self-defense, you must typically show that you had a rational belief that you were in danger and that your response was equal to the threat.

9. Can Battery Claims Be Dismissed?

Accusations of assault can be removed if the prosecutor does not have enough proof, the complainant changes their statement, or there are juridical problems with how the charges was managed (such as illegal methods).

10. What Defines Aggravated Assault?

Aggravated assault is a higher-degree variation of assault, usually including a lethal tool or causing serious bodily harm. It is generally charged as a serious offense and results in harsher punishments.

17. Can the Accuser Remove Aggression Accusations?

While accusers can seek that accusations be withdrawn, the legal action is ultimately up to the state attorney. In many cases, prosecutors will continue with the charges even if the victim no longer intends to pursue the case, particularly in family violence situations.

18. What Is Battery With a Dangerous Object?

Battery with a dangerous tool involves wielding a tool that can cause serious injury, such as a firearm, car, or other object. This offense is generally charged as serious battery and results in severe penalties, including significant incarceration.

23. Could I Be Held Accountable for Battery for Acting in Defense of Another?

Yes, however you might have a justification if you were responding in protecting someone else. Like a self-defense claim, you must demonstrate that you genuinely thought that the individual was in immediate harm and that your response were proportionate to the threat.

24. What Is Agreed Combat in a Battery Incident?

Consensual fighting occurs when both individuals agree to fight, and it can sometimes be raised as a legal argument to aggression accusations. However, even in cases of agreed combat, you may still be held legally responsible, notably if severe injuries took place.

25. How Is Domestic Assault Different From Basic Battery?

Family aggression involves threats of harm or intimidation against a household member, cohabitant, or intimate partner. It is dealt with more severely than general aggression due to the tie between the accuser and the offender.

26. How Do Legal Restrictions Impact Aggression Claims?

If a legal restriction is put in place against you, it prevents contact with the alleged victim. Ignoring a protective order can lead to additional penalties, even if the original aggression claim is still under investigation.
